"Arnika" – Sribni Korabli

March, 2026

A Lviv-based vocal and instrumental ensemble of the 1970s that worked in the genres of pop-rock and jazz-rock arrangements of folk songs as well as original music. They combined melodic sensibility, modern arrangements, and elements of experimental sound, becoming one of the most well-known musical groups in Ukraine at the time.

TILʼKYTAK Records is an independent Ukrainian label founded in 2023. Who are we? Vinyl culture enthusiasts, audiophiles, Ukrainian-music devotees, and researchers. Our focus is simple and unwavering — the Ukrainian music scene.
Whether you’ve been collecting records your whole life or you’re just discovering the world of vinyl — here you’ll find Ukrainian music truly worth having in your collection. We do this with expertise and passion. Only this way. And no other.

How to care for vinyl records so they last a long time?
To keep your vinyl records in great condition for years, follow these simple tips: * Store records vertically in clean sleeves, away from direct sunlight and moisture. * Before playing, gently remove dust with an anti-static brush. * Use a clean stylus and a turntable with properly adjusted tonearm pressure. * Avoid sudden temperature changes and contact with liquids. Proper care ensures clear sound and long-lasting enjoyment of your collection.

Which player is suitable for a beginner who is just starting to get acquainted with vinyl?
If you’re just starting your journey with vinyl, choosing the right turntable is crucial, as it affects both sound quality and the longevity of your records. Here are the main features to pay attention to: 1. Drive Type: * Belt-drive – quiet and smooth, with minimal vibration; ideal for home listening. * Direct-drive – quick start and stable speed; often preferred by DJs, though usually a bit more expensive. 2. Tonearm and Stylus: * Look for a tonearm with adjustable tracking force and anti-skate, which ensures the stylus sits properly in the groove, reduces record wear, and delivers clean sound. * Use a quality stylus and keep it clean — a dirty or worn stylus can damage records and compromise audio. 3. Audio Output: * Some turntables include a built-in phono preamp, allowing direct connection to regular speakers. * If you have a separate Hi-Fi system, make sure the turntable has a phono output or can connect via an external preamp. 4. Build Quality and Stability: * The turntable should be sturdy, free of wobble or vibration. * Choose reputable entry-level brands (Audio-Technica, Pro-Ject, Rega, Fluance) for reliability and sound quality. 5. Extra Features for Convenience: * Automatic start/stop can be helpful for beginners. * A built-in USB output for digitizing vinyl is a nice bonus for collectors. Following these guidelines will give you clear, rich sound, protect your records, and make your vinyl listening experience enjoyable and stress-free.
